Data Publication

Counter-clockwise rotations in the southern Apennines during the Pleistocene: paleomagnetic evidence from the Matera area (Dataset)

P.J.J. Scheepers | C.G. Langereis | F.J. Hilgen

Magnetics Information Consortium (MagIC)

(2006)

Paleomagnetic, rock magnetic, or geomagnetic data found in the MagIC data repository from a paper titled: Counter-clockwise rotations in the southern Apennines during the Pleistocene: paleomagnetic evidence from the Matera area
